首页/ 题库 / [单选题]若有如下程序; #define X 3 的答案

若有如下程序; #define X 3 #define Y X+1 #define Z Y*Y/2 main() { int n; for(n=1;n<=Z;n++) printf("%d",n); } 则程序运行后的输出结果是( )

单选题
2022-08-11 02:59
A、12345
B、1234567
C、12345678
D、123456
查看答案

正确答案
D

试题解析

标签:
感兴趣题目
下列程序段的执行结果为( )。 x=1:y=2 z=x=y Print x;y;z
若有定义:intx,y,z;语句x=(y=z=3,++y,z+=y);运行后x的值为()。
设x=1,y=2和z=3,则表达式y+=z((/++x的值是
设x=1,y=2,z=3则执行语句y+=z--/++x;后y的值是()
设 x = 1 ,y = 2 , z = 3, 则表达式 y+=z--/++x 的值是()
设x=1,y=2和z=3,则表达式y+=z—/++x的值是( )。
设x=1,y=2,z=3,则表达式y+=z--/++x的值是( )。

有两个二元随机变量X和Y,它们的联合概率为P[X=0,Y=0]=1/8,P[X=0,Y=1]=3/8,P[X=1,Y=1]=1/8,P[X=1,Y=0]=3/8。定义另一随机变量Z=XY,试计算:
(1)H(X),H(Y),H(Z),H(XZ),H(YZ),H(XYZ);
(2)H(X/Y),H(Y/X),H(X/Z),H(Z/X),H(Y/Z),H(Z/Y),H(X/YZ),H(Y/XZ),H(Z/XY);
(3)I(X;Y),I(X;Z),I(Y;Z),I(X;Y/Z),I(Y;Z/X),I(X;Z/Y)。

若有如下程序; #define X 3 #define Y X+1 #define Z Y*Y/2 main() { int n; for(n=1;n<=Z;n++) printf("%d",n); } 则程序运行后的输出结果是( )
若有宏定义如下: #define X 5 #define Y X+1 #define Z Y*X/2以下程序段的输出结果是______。 int a;a=Y; printf("%d ",Z); printf("%d ",--a);
设有以下宏定义: # define N 3 # defi0ne Y(n)(N+1) * n) 则执行语句“z=2*(N+Y(5+1));”后,z的值为 ( )
设随机变量X与Y相互独立,X的概率分布为P{X=i}=1/3(i=-1,0,1),Y的概率密度函数为 ,设Z=X+Y。求:   (1)P{Z≤1/2|X=0};   (2)Z的概率密度函数。
相关题目
以下程序的运行结果是( )#include”stdio.h”#define FUDGE(y) 2.84+y#define PR(a) printf(“%d”,(int)(a))#define PRINT1(a) PR(a);put char(‘\n’)main(){int x=2;PRINT1(FUDGE(5)*x);}
设 x = 1 , y = 2 , z = 3,则表达式 y+=z--/++x 的值是( )。
设int x=1,y=3,z;,执行z=x>y++x:y++;后,z的值是 。
直线L:X-2/3=y+2/1=z-3/-4与平面π:x+y+z=3的位置关系为【】.
下列程序段执行后x、y和z的值分别是() int x=10,y=20,z=30; if(x>y)z=x;x=y;y=z;
若x=3,y=z=4,则下列表达式的值分别为( )(1)(z>=y>=x)?1:0(2)y+=z,x*=y
执行下面程序段后,2值为( )。 int x=1,y=2,z=3; z=z/(float)(x/y):
执行下面程序段后,2值为( )。 int x=1,y=2,z=3; z=z/(float)(x/y);
执行下面程序段后,z值为( )。int x=1,y=2,z=3;z=z/(float)(x/y);
设x=1,y=2,z=3,则表达式y+=z--/++x的值是()
若有以下宏定义:#define N 2#define Y(n)((N+1)*n)则执行语句z=2*(N+Y(5));后的结果是( )。
若有以下宏定义: # define N 2 # define Y(n) ((N+1)*n) 则执行语句z=2*(N+Y(5));后的结果是
设有以下宏定义: #define N 3 #define Y(n) ((N+1)*n)则执行以下语句后,z的值为______。 z=2*(N+Y(3+2));
阅读下列程序段,则程序的输出结果为 #include"stdio.h" #define M(X,Y)(X)*(Y) #define N(X,Y)(X)/(Y) main() int a=5,b=6,c=8,k; k=N(M(a,b),c); printf("%d\n",k);
假定w、x、y、z、m均为int型变量;有如下程序段: w=1;x=2;y=3;z=4; m=(w<><>
若有如下程序: SET TALK OFF INPUT TO X FOR i=1 TO 3 INPUT TO Y IF Y>X X=Y ENDIF ENDFOR ?X RETURN 本程序的功能是( )。
执行下面程序段后,z值为( )。 intx=1,y=2,z=3; z=z/(float)(x/y);
设x=1 , y=2 , z=3则执行语句 y+=z--/++x;后y的值是()。
设x、y、z均为int型变量,则执行以下语句后,x、y, z的值为( ) X=1; y=0; Z=2; y++&&++Z ||++ X;
For all real values of x and y, let x◆y be defined by the equation x◆y = 2 -xy. If -1 < a < 0 and 0 < b < 1, then which of the following must be true?
广告位招租WX:84302438

免费的网站请分享给朋友吧